Warning: file_exists(): open_basedir restriction in effect. File(/www/wwwroot/value.calculator.city/wp-content/plugins/wp-rocket/) is not within the allowed path(s): (/www/wwwroot/cal5.calculator.city/:/tmp/) in /www/wwwroot/cal5.calculator.city/wp-content/advanced-cache.php on line 17
Calculating Lattice Energy Using Hess&#39 - Calculator City

Calculating Lattice Energy Using Hess&#39






Lattice Energy Calculator (Using Hess’s Law)


Lattice Energy Calculator

An advanced tool to determine the lattice energy of ionic compounds using the Born-Haber cycle, an application of Hess’s Law. This expert Lattice Energy Calculator helps students and chemists understand crystal bond strength.

Calculate Lattice Energy


The total enthalpy change when one mole of a compound is formed from its elements. (kJ/mol)
Please enter a valid number.


Energy required to convert one mole of the solid metal into gaseous atoms. (kJ/mol)
Please enter a valid positive number.


Energy required to remove one electron from one mole of gaseous metal atoms. (kJ/mol)
Please enter a valid positive number.


Energy required to break the bonds in one mole of the non-metal to form gaseous atoms (e.g., ½ Cl₂ → Cl). (kJ/mol)
Please enter a valid positive number.


Enthalpy change when one mole of gaseous non-metal atoms gains an electron. (kJ/mol)
Please enter a valid number.


Calculated Lattice Energy (ΔHL)

-787.00 kJ/mol
Sum of Input Enthalpies
376.00 kJ/mol

Formation Enthalpy
-411.00 kJ/mol

Formula Used: ΔHLattice = ΔHFormation – (ΔHAtomization(Metal) + IEMetal + ΔHAtomization(Non-metal) + EANon-metal)

Born-Haber Cycle Energy Contributions
Dynamic chart of energy inputs (positive) and outputs (negative) in the Born-Haber cycle. This chart is a visual aid provided by our Lattice Energy Calculator.

What is Lattice Energy?

Lattice energy is a measure of the strength of the forces between the ions in an ionic solid. More specifically, it is the energy released when one mole of a solid ionic compound is formed from its constituent gaseous ions. Because this process is always exothermic, the lattice energy value (by this definition) is always negative. Alternatively, it can be defined as the energy required to separate one mole of an ionic compound into its gaseous ions, in which case the value is positive. A high magnitude for lattice energy indicates strong ionic bonds and a very stable crystal lattice. This value is crucial for chemists as it cannot be measured directly but can be calculated using a powerful theoretical tool called the Born-Haber cycle, which this Lattice Energy Calculator automates.

Anyone studying chemistry, from high school students to professional researchers, can benefit from understanding lattice energy. It provides deep insights into the properties of ionic compounds, such as melting point, hardness, and solubility. A common misconception is that lattice energy is the same as the enthalpy of formation; however, the enthalpy of formation involves starting from elements in their standard states (e.g., solid sodium and chlorine gas), not gaseous ions. Our Lattice Energy Calculator makes this distinction clear.

Lattice Energy Formula and Mathematical Explanation

The calculation of lattice energy is an excellent application of Hess’s Law, which states that the total enthalpy change for a reaction is independent of the pathway taken. The Born-Haber cycle is a hypothetical energy cycle that breaks down the formation of an ionic solid into a series of steps whose enthalpy changes are known. The final unknown, lattice energy, can then be solved for. Our Lattice Energy Calculator uses the following rearranged formula:

ΔHL = ΔHf – (ΔHsub + IE + ΔHat(nm) + EA)

This equation is derived from the fundamental principle of the cycle: the direct path (enthalpy of formation) must equal the indirect path (sum of all other steps, including lattice energy).

Variables in the Lattice Energy Calculation
Variable Meaning Unit Typical Range
ΔHL Lattice Energy kJ/mol -600 to -10,000
ΔHf Enthalpy of Formation kJ/mol -300 to -1,200
ΔHsub / ΔHat(m) Enthalpy of Atomization (Metal) kJ/mol +80 to +300
IE Ionization Energy kJ/mol +400 to +1,000 (1st IE)
ΔHat(nm) Enthalpy of Atomization (Non-metal) kJ/mol +100 to +300
EA Electron Affinity kJ/mol -100 to -400
Table showing the typical variables used by the Lattice Energy Calculator.

Practical Examples (Real-World Use Cases)

Example 1: Sodium Chloride (NaCl)

Let’s calculate the lattice energy of table salt (NaCl). This is a classic example used in chemistry education and is the default in our Lattice Energy Calculator. The required enthalpy values are:

  • Enthalpy of Formation (ΔHf): -411 kJ/mol
  • Enthalpy of Atomization of Na (ΔHat): +107 kJ/mol
  • First Ionization Energy of Na (IE): +496 kJ/mol
  • Bond Energy of Cl₂ (½ ΔHBE): +122 kJ/mol
  • Electron Affinity of Cl (EA): -349 kJ/mol

Using the formula: ΔHL = -411 – (107 + 496 + 122 + (-349)) = -411 – (376) = -787 kJ/mol. This highly negative value indicates that NaCl forms a very stable crystal lattice, which explains its high melting point (801 °C).

Example 2: Magnesium Oxide (MgO)

Magnesium oxide involves ions with +2 and -2 charges, leading to a much stronger lattice. Note that second ionization energies and electron affinities are required.

  • Enthalpy of Formation (ΔHf): -602 kJ/mol
  • Enthalpy of Atomization of Mg: +148 kJ/mol
  • 1st + 2nd Ionization Energy of Mg: +738 + 1451 = +2189 kJ/mol
  • Bond Energy of O₂ (½ ΔHBE): +249 kJ/mol
  • 1st + 2nd Electron Affinity of O: -141 + 798 = +657 kJ/mol

Using the Lattice Energy Calculator formula: ΔHL = -602 – (148 + 2189 + 249 + 657) = -602 – (3243) = -3845 kJ/mol. This value is almost five times larger than NaCl’s, reflecting the much stronger electrostatic attraction between Mg²⁺ and O²⁻ ions.

How to Use This Lattice Energy Calculator

Our Lattice Energy Calculator is designed for ease of use and accuracy. Follow these simple steps to find the lattice energy for any binary ionic compound:

  1. Gather Your Data: Find the five necessary enthalpy values for your compound: formation, metal atomization, metal ionization energy, non-metal atomization, and non-metal electron affinity.
  2. Enter the Values: Input each value into the corresponding field. The calculator updates in real-time. Pay close attention to the signs (positive or negative).
  3. Read the Results: The primary result, the Lattice Energy (ΔHL), is displayed prominently. You can also see intermediate calculations, like the sum of the positive enthalpy steps.
  4. Analyze the Chart: The dynamic bar chart provides a visual representation of the energy contributions, helping you understand how each step impacts the final lattice energy.
  5. Reset or Copy: Use the “Reset” button to return to the default values (NaCl) or “Copy Results” to save your work. Using a reliable Lattice Energy Calculator is key to accurate results.

Key Factors That Affect Lattice Energy Results

The magnitude of the lattice energy is primarily determined by two factors, based on Coulomb’s Law, which describes the electrostatic force between charged particles. Understanding these is more important than just using a Lattice Energy Calculator.

  • Ionic Charge: The greater the magnitude of the charges on the ions, the stronger the electrostatic attraction and the more exothermic the lattice energy. An MgO lattice (Mg²⁺, O²⁻) has a much higher lattice energy than an NaCl lattice (Na⁺, Cl⁻).
  • Ionic Radius (Distance): The smaller the ions, the closer they can get to each other in the crystal lattice. This shorter distance (smaller ionic radii) results in a stronger electrostatic attraction and a more exothermic lattice energy. For example, LiF has a higher lattice energy than CsI because Li⁺ and F⁻ ions are much smaller than Cs⁺ and I⁻ ions.
  • Crystal Structure: The specific arrangement of ions in the crystal lattice (e.g., face-centered cubic vs. body-centered cubic) affects the total electrostatic energy. This is accounted for by the Madelung constant in more advanced lattice energy equations.
  • Covalency: While the Born-Haber cycle assumes 100% ionic bonding, many compounds exhibit some degree of covalent character. This can cause a discrepancy between the theoretical value from a Lattice Energy Calculator and the experimental value.
  • Electron Configuration: The ease of forming ions (ionization energy and electron affinity) directly impacts the energy balance of the Born-Haber cycle.
  • Polarizability: Large anions can have their electron clouds distorted by small, highly charged cations, introducing a covalent character to the bond and affecting the overall lattice stability.

Frequently Asked Questions (FAQ)

1. Why is lattice energy usually a negative value?

By convention, lattice energy is defined as the energy *released* when gaseous ions form a solid lattice. Since energy release is an exothermic process, the enthalpy change is negative. Some sources define it as the energy required to break the lattice, in which case the value would be positive. Our Lattice Energy Calculator uses the formation (exothermic) convention.

2. Can lattice energy be measured directly in an experiment?

No, it is impossible to directly measure the energy change of converting gaseous ions into a solid crystal. That is why indirect methods like the Born-Haber cycle are so essential. We measure the other enthalpy values experimentally and then use Hess’s Law to calculate the lattice energy.

3. What’s the difference between lattice energy and lattice enthalpy?

They are very similar and often used interchangeably. Technically, they are related by the equation ΔH = ΔU + PΔV. For the formation of a solid from a gas, the PΔV term is very small, so the lattice energy (ΔU) and lattice enthalpy (ΔH) are nearly identical in value.

4. How does lattice energy relate to a compound’s melting point?

Generally, a higher magnitude of lattice energy corresponds to a higher melting point. More energy is required to break the stronger ionic bonds in the solid to allow it to become a liquid. For example, MgO (ΔHL ≈ -3845 kJ/mol) has a melting point of 2852 °C, while NaCl (ΔHL ≈ -787 kJ/mol) melts at 801 °C.

5. Why is the second electron affinity often positive (endothermic)?

The first electron affinity (e.g., O + e⁻ → O⁻) is usually exothermic. However, adding a second electron (O⁻ + e⁻ → O²⁻) requires overcoming the repulsion between the negative ion and the electron, which requires an input of energy, making the process endothermic (a positive value).

6. Does this Lattice Energy Calculator work for any ionic compound?

This calculator is designed for simple binary ionic compounds (one type of metal cation, one type of non-metal anion). For more complex polyatomic ionic compounds (like CaCO₃), the energy cycle involves additional terms like the lattice energy of the polyatomic ion itself, which is beyond the scope of this tool.

7. What causes discrepancies between calculated and experimental values?

The Born-Haber cycle assumes a perfectly ionic model. Discrepancies arise due to covalent character in the bonds and polarization effects, which are not accounted for in this simple calculation. The value from a Lattice Energy Calculator is a theoretical one.

8. Why do I need a Lattice Energy Calculator?

A Lattice Energy Calculator automates a complex, multi-step calculation, reducing the chance of arithmetic errors. It provides instant results and helps visualize the energy contributions, making it an excellent learning and teaching tool for understanding chemical thermodynamics and ionic bonding.

Related Tools and Internal Resources

For further exploration of chemical thermodynamics, check out these related tools and articles:

© 2026 Professional Date Tools. All rights reserved. The Lattice Energy Calculator is for educational purposes.



Leave a Reply

Your email address will not be published. Required fields are marked *